The Historical Significance of Black Churches in NYC

The origin of Black churches in New York City can be traced back to the early 19th century. The rise of these institutions was marked by the desire for a place of worship that was free from the oppressive constraints observed in predominantly white churches. They provided a sanctuary for African Americans where they could nurture their faith, preserve their cultural identity, and foster a sense of community.

Throughout the decades, these churches became more than just places of worship; they transformed into community hubs that offered educational programs, organized social justice initiatives, and created a support system for those facing discrimination or hardship.

The Role of Black Churches in the Community

Today, the best black churches in NYC are instrumental in nurturing not only the spiritual lives of their congregations but also driving community development. These churches actively participate in various outreach initiatives, including:

  • Food Distribution: Many churches run food banks and soup kitchens to combat hunger in their neighborhoods.
  • Educational Programs: Mentorship programs, tutoring sessions, and scholarships help empower youth and promote education.
  • Health Services: Health fairs and screenings are often organized to promote health literacy and care access.
  • Social Justice Advocacy: Many churches are active in movements that seek to address systemic inequalities affecting their communities.

1. Abyssinian Baptist Church

Founded in 1808, the Abyssinian Baptist Church is one of the oldest black churches in New York City. Located in the heart of Harlem, it has a rich history of involvement in the civil rights movement. The church not only emphasizes spiritual growth but also actively engages in community development through educational initiatives and outreach programs.

2. The Riverside Church

Known for its stunning architecture and commitment to social justice, The Riverside Church was established by the Baptist preacher Harry Emerson Fosdick in 1930. It has long been a gathering place for civil rights activities and continues to promote equality and justice in the community through advocacy and inclusive worship practices.

Impact of Black Churches on Social Justice Movements

Black churches have played a crucial role in various social justice movements throughout history. From the Abolitionist movement through the Civil Rights movement, these institutions have been at the forefront of advocating for equality, human rights, and justice. With passionate leaders and congregations, they have utilized their platforms to mobilize communities, educate the public, and influence policy changes.

Today, many black churches continue to advocate for issues such as police reform, voting rights, and economic equality. Their involvement is vital in addressing systemic racism and injustices within society. Through community forums, workshops, and partnerships with local organizations, these churches drive meaningful dialogues and promote collective action for change.
